Abstract: the article deals with the problems, principles and current directions of financial resources management in the conditions of economic crisis. Knowledge and use of the basic principles of financial management in the current crisis, such as early diagnosis of crisis phenomena, prompt response to crisis manifestations, the adequacy of measures and policies, as well as the full implementation of internal capabilities, will allow businesses to prevent loss of solvency, increase competitiveness and efficiency. According to the results of the study, the main factors and causes of financial problems of financial management in business in the Russian practice are identified. In the light of current trends, the development of analytical diagnostic functions of business management is becoming important. Scientific and practical aspects of the development of the studied issues revealed the insufficiency, in modern conditions, of the existing traditional analytical approach to assessing the financial condition of an organization based on financial reporting information, the need to improve the analysis tools, take into account industry specifics, and refine existing criteria values that are adequate to the economic situation, in order to make optimal management decisions on extremely urgent problems of ensuring financial viability. The expediency of using additional methodological tools for analyzing financial statements, in particular, assessing the cash flows of the organization and the presence of overdue debts, is justified. A refined system of performance evaluation criteria is proposed as an information and analytical monitoring of the financial condition of organizations, in the context of analyzing the structure of assets, profitability of activities, payment and settlement discipline, and the sufficiency of own and monetary funds. Practical use of modern principles of financial management and the proposed analytical tools will allow controlling efficiency and consistency.
